        Climate Change   --   "Curious, Confused, Concerned?"

The Birch Aquarium at the world-renowned Scripps Institution of
Oceanography, at the University of California, San Diego, presents an
informative website on global climate change. Gentle Members considering
the possibility that there may be more to the issue than just hot air, will
find introductory material at the site.

"Climate shapes our lives and structures our world. Climate determines how
we live, when and where food can be grown, and where the different
ecosystems that support life on the planet thrive. As a result, any change
in climate will affect each and every one of us. Many scientists are
concerned that global warming, from an increase in carbon dioxide and other
gases in the atmosphere, may change Earth=92s climate considerably within
the next century." - from the website

Not intended for the committed environmentalist, the site offers an
elementary overview on such topics as how ancient climates are determined,
the greenhouse effect, changes in climate, man's role in climate change and
the possible consequences.
